首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

facebook php响应的数据解析

Facebook PHP响应的数据解析是指在使用PHP编程语言与Facebook API进行交互时,对从Facebook返回的响应数据进行解析和处理的过程。

概念:

数据解析是将原始数据转换为可读、可操作的格式的过程。在Facebook PHP响应的数据解析中,通常会将返回的数据解析为PHP数组或对象,以便开发人员可以轻松地访问和处理这些数据。

分类:

Facebook PHP响应的数据解析可以分为以下两种常见的方式:

  1. 手动解析:开发人员可以使用PHP内置的字符串处理函数和数组函数来手动解析返回的数据。这种方式需要开发人员具备一定的数据处理和解析技巧。
  2. 使用第三方库:开发人员可以使用一些第三方库,如Facebook官方提供的PHP SDK或其他流行的HTTP请求库,来简化数据解析的过程。这些库通常提供了封装好的方法和类,可以直接将返回的数据解析为PHP数组或对象。

优势:

使用合适的数据解析方法可以带来以下优势:

  1. 简化开发:合适的数据解析方法可以简化开发人员处理返回数据的过程,减少开发时间和工作量。
  2. 提高可读性:将返回的数据解析为PHP数组或对象后,开发人员可以更直观地理解和操作这些数据,提高代码的可读性和可维护性。
  3. 方便数据处理:解析后的数据可以方便地进行数据处理、筛选、过滤等操作,以满足具体业务需求。

应用场景:

Facebook PHP响应的数据解析适用于与Facebook API进行交互的各种场景,例如:

  1. 获取用户信息:解析返回的用户数据,以便在应用中显示用户信息或进行其他操作。
  2. 发布动态:解析返回的发布结果,以便获取动态的ID或其他相关信息。
  3. 获取好友列表:解析返回的好友数据,以便在应用中展示好友列表或进行其他操作。

推荐的腾讯云相关产品:

腾讯云提供了一系列与云计算相关的产品和服务,以下是一些推荐的产品和产品介绍链接地址:

  1. 云服务器(CVM):提供弹性计算能力,满足各类业务需求。产品介绍链接
  2. 云数据库 MySQL 版(CDB):提供高性能、可扩展的关系型数据库服务。产品介绍链接
  3. 云函数(SCF):无服务器计算服务,支持事件驱动的函数计算。产品介绍链接
  4. 人工智能平台(AI):提供丰富的人工智能服务和工具,如图像识别、语音识别等。产品介绍链接

以上是关于Facebook PHP响应的数据解析的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

实例解析php数据类型

NULl唯一可能值就是NULL 注意:PHP是一种弱类型语言,其变量没有数据类型,但是变量所存储数据有对应数据类型 整型数据类型:采用8个字节存储,并且提供了多种进制整数存储方式 $num =...字符串数据类型 在PHP中,凡是用户输入数据和程序员使用了引号(单引号和双引号)定义数据,系统都理解为字符串,PHP7字符串长度理论上无限制 单引号和双引号都可以定义字符串,但是彼此是有区别的:...–单引号中只能解析少量转义符号:\’,\ –双引号中能解析较多转义字符:$,\”,\n 双引号中能够解析嵌套在字符串中php变量( 变量要与其他字符串分离,使用{} ) $a = "你好";...1、PHP数组中元素理论上没有数量限制 2、PHP数组中可以动态添加元素 3、PHP数组元素值可以是任意数据类型 4、PHP数组下标可以是纯数字(索引数组),纯字符串(关联数组),混合数字和字符串(...类型转换 自动转换:PHP会自动根据数据要参与运算场景来将不符合条件数据类型数据转换目标类型数据,这种转换不会改变变量原来数据类型 强制转换:使用 int(目标类型)格式来转换数据

86510

DeepText:Facebook文本解析引擎

Facebook上进行文本解析需要处理很多困难扩展性及语言方面的问题。用传统NLP技术解决这些问题效果不佳。...这种方式要求每个单词在训练数据中拼写正确,这样才能够被解析。 采用深度学习,我们可以使用“单词嵌入(word embedding)”这样数学概念,这样就能够记录单词之间语义关系。...深度学习提供了一个很好框架,可以提升这些单词嵌入,使用带标签较小集合进一步改进。相对传统方式,这是一个明显优势,后者需要大量人工标签过数据并且对新任务响应非常困难。...采用手工方式很难生成这些数据集,于是我们开始尝试使用公共Facebook页面采用半监督方式生成这样数据集。很容易想象,这些页面上都是和特定主题相关帖子。...Facebook上非结构化数据提供了一个独一无二机会,用多种不同语言对文本解析系统进行自动训练,使得自然语言处理技术发展能更进一步。

1.4K20

Vue3 Reactivity数据响应式原理解析

Vue3 如火如荼,与其干等,不如花一个下午茶时间来看下最新响应数据是如何实现吧。...似乎讲了太多题外话,与其发牢骚不如静下心来,一起学习一下Reactivity一些基本原理吧,相信阅读完文章你会对vue 3数据响应式有更加深刻理解。...原理篇 当了解了前置一些知识后,就要开始@vue/reactivity源码解析篇章了。...Effect 对于整个 effect 模块,将其分为三个部分来去阅读: effect:副作用函数 teack: 依赖收集,在proxy代理数据get时调用 trigger: 触发响应,在proxy代理数据发生变化时候调用...在get时候都调用了track,set时候都调用了trigger effect是数据响应核心。

42520

PHP代码解析过程

对于程序员来说这又是一个挣零花钱好机会,这是一个最好时代。 国家十三五规划(2016-2020)给腾讯和阿里都分了任务,腾讯主管智慧医疗、警务、政务。阿里主管云计算、大数据、工业。...PHP属于热更新语言,在不开Opcache缓存情况下修改代码能实时生效,因为这个灵活特性也导致PHP在发布代码时容易遇到问题,这点和前端资源发布很像。...a.php -> 新 b.php -> c.php 对用户来说这次请求多半会报错。如果当前请求有I/O操作更会造成灾难性后果。...这里说了"可能"、"如果"、"凑巧"三个概率性词,在编程时千万不要相信概率,请迷信墨菲定律。 PHP是如何解析执行? 1....所以只要知道includePHP文件是什么时候被加载到内存,问题也迎刃而解。 假设我们有两个php文件,内容如下: //a.php <?

1.4K20

SpringMVC数据响应(一)

4.SpringMVC数据响应 4.1.SpringMVC数据响应方式(理解) 1.页面跳转 直接返回字符串 通过ModelAndView对象返回 2.回写数据 直接返回字符串(解析...json数据) 返回对象或集合 4.2.SpringMVC数据响应-页面跳转-返回字符串形式(应用) [外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-OxdfClO3...4.3.SpringMVC数据响应-页面跳转-返回ModelAndView形式1(应用) 在Controller中方法返回ModelAndView对象,并且设置视图名称 @RequestMapping...("login"); return modelAndView; } 4.4.SpringMVC数据响应-页面跳转-返回ModelAndView形式2(应用) 在Controller...); return "login"; } 4.5.SpringMVC数据响应-页面跳转-返回ModelAndView3(应用) 在Controller方法形参上可以直接使用原生

16620

Golang HTTP请求Json响应解析方法以及解析失败原因

一、Golang HTTP请求Json响应解析方法 在Golang Web编程中,json格式是常见传输格式,那么json数据要怎么解析呢?...例如下面请求地址 http://api.open-notify.org/astros.json 响应数据如下: { "number": 3, "message": "success", "people...json数据到结构体里示例 package main import ( "encoding/json" "fmt" "io/ioutil" "log" "net/http" "time"...= nil { log.Fatal(jsonErr) } fmt.Println(people1.Number) } 按照以上方法可以正确解析数据 二、Golang json解析失败示例与原因...,无法正常解析了 原因 其实原因很简单,golang首字母大小写意味着改变了成员访问权限,小写就变成私有的了,不同package是无法访问其他package私有成员,导致json.Marshal

21210

超全HTTP请求响应码详细解析

HTTP响应状态码表 1xx: 信息 状态码 英文 描述 100 Continue 服务器仅接收到部分请求,但是一旦服务器并没有拒绝该请求,客户端应该继续发送其余请求。...301 Moved Permanently 所请求页面已经转移至新url。 302 Moved Temporarily 所请求页面已经临时转移至新url。...客户端有缓冲文档并发出了一个条件性请求(一般是提供If-Modified-Since头表示客户只想比指定日期更新文档)。服务器告诉客户,原来缓冲文档还可以继续使用。...405 Method Not Allowed 请求中指定方法不被允许。 406 Not Acceptable 服务器生成响应无法被客户端所接受。...服务器不支持所请求功能。 502 Bad Gateway 请求未完成。服务器从上游服务器收到一个无效响应。 502.1 / CGI 应用程序超时。 · 502.2 / CGI 应用程序出错。

1.5K20

【前端进阶基础】VUE响应数据原理 订阅-发布模式解析

vue框架两个抽象核心:虚拟DOM和相应式数据原理 关于虚拟DOM核心算法,我们上一章已经基本解析过了,详细见 React && VUE Virtual DomDiff算法统一之路 snabbdom.js...解读 关于响应数据原理,我们先看张图 你 ‘ (4).png ?...此后每当有数据改变,都将通知相应 Watcher 执行回调函数。...我们知道,Dom 上通过指令或者双大括号绑定数据,会为数据进行添加观察者watcher,当实例化Watcher时候 会触发属性getter方法,此时会调用dep.depend()。...这也就是简单数据响应式,其实还需要注意是: 当数据getter触发后,会收集依赖,但也不是所有的触发方式都会收集依赖,只有通过watcher触发getter会收集依赖:if (Dep.target

67230

通过实例解析PHP数据类型转换方法

PHP数据类型转换属于强制转换,允许转换PHP数据类型有: (int)、(integer):转换成整形 (float)、(double)、(real):转换成浮点型 (string):转换成字符串...(bool)、(boolean):转换成布尔类型 (array):转换成数组 (object):转换成对象 PHP数据类型有三种转换方式: 在要转换变量之前加上用括号括起来目标类型 使用3个具体类型转换函数...php $num1=3.14; $num2=(int)$num1; var_dump($num1); //输出float(3.14) var_dump($num2); //输出int(3...php $num4=12.8; $flg=settype($num4,"int"); var_dump($flg); //输出bool(true) var_dump($num4); //...以上就是本文全部内容,希望对大家学习有所帮助。

43420

php引用类型底层解析

php $a = "string"; $b = &$a; echo $a; echo $b; $b = "hello"; echo $b; echo $a; unset($b); echo $b;...也是由gc和zval组成,而且对应zval中u1type为6,是字符串类型 (gdb) p *$6.value.ref.val.value.str $9 = {gc = {refcount =...是由gc和zval组成,而且对应zval中u1type为6,是字符串类型 (gdb) p *$11.value.ref.val.value.str $13 = {gc = {refcount =...是由gc和zval组成,而且对应zval中u1type为6,是字符串类型 (gdb) p *$15.value.ref.val.value.str $17 = {gc = {refcount =...,仅仅是把b中u1type改为了0,为null类型,其余地址等信息都未改变,所以对应$a是不会有任何改变 所以后面在打印$a过程中,一切都是正常,以下为$a打印过程 (gdb) p *

3.9K10

Vue数据响应式原理

什么是响应式 “响应式”,是指当数据改变后,Vue 会通知到使用该数据代码。例如,视图渲染中使用了数据数据改变后,视图也会自动更新。...响应式原理 Vue 响应式原理是核心是通过 ES5 保护对象 Object.defindeProperty 中访问器属性中 get 和 set 方法,data 中声明属性都被添加了访问器属性...,当读取 data 中数据时自动调用 get 方法,当修改 data 中数据时,自动调用 set 方法,检测到数据变化,会通知观察者 Wacher,观察者 Wacher自动触发重新render 当前组件...响应式缺陷 vue不能监听数组变化 Object.defindProperty虽然能够实现双向绑定了,但是还是有缺点,只能对对象属性进行数据劫持,所以会深度遍历整个对象,不管层级有多深,只要数组中嵌套有对象...var vm = new Vue({ data:{   a:1 } }) // `vm.a` 是响应 vm.b = 2 // `vm.b` 是非响应 Vue不允许在已经创建实例上动态添加新根级响应式属性

79820

(六)监听响应数据变化

watch 监听响应数据变化 一、监听基本类型响应数据 const data = ref('') // 监听基本类型参数,第一个传递参数是需要监听值, 第一个参数是一个回调函数,回调函数又两个值...,一个是,监听数据变化过后值,第二个是变化之前值 watch(data, (newVal, oldVal) => { console.log(newVal, oldVal) }) //...ref 拆解过后值,也就是value ,监听拆解过后值需要使用 回到函数形式监听 二、监听对象中基本类型响应性属性 说明 监听对象中基本类型响应性属性,就是说只监听对象中某一个属性...,比如说只监听 options.value.user.naem ,并且如果是监听对象中基本类型响应性属性时候,第一个参数需要使用 回调函数形式 () => options.value.user.name...,可以监听到前后数据变化 }, { deep: treu } ) 四、同时监听多个响应数据 监听多个响应数据 watch 还至此同时监听多个响应数据,这样的话

1.6K20
领券